Early years

Regal's debut release ''Mute'' EP arrived back in 2012 when he was signed to Dustin Zahn's label Enemy. Shortly after he founded his own label Involve and released its first EP ''Involve 01''. In 2016, Figure released a collaboration between Len Faki and Regal entitled ''The End'', marking Regal's third release on the record label at that time. Recent projects

In 2021, following plenty of EP releases on renowned labels and after having been featured on the cover of DJ Mag Spain, Regal released his debut album ''Remember Why You Started''. The album tells the story of his personal struggles and self-discovery, giving insight into the artist's life behind the scenes. The project, an introspection of Regal's story, caught the attention of listeners globally. The album features both tracks he started working on years ago, and some others brand new. Following the release of ''Remember Why You Started'', three remix EPs were released, featuring reworks from artists such as Slam, Thomas P. Heckmann and Sita Abellán. In 2024, Regal announced a new 10-track album called ''The Final Chapter'', to be released under his new alias ACIDBOY, a nickname that his fans had given him after his first releases on his label Involve Records. Involve Records

Regal's own label Involve Records, founded back in 2012, has become a core hub for both his solo productions and stand out collaborations with the likes of Alien Rain and Amelie Lens, whilst also welcoming artists such as Boston 168, FJAAK, Cosmin TRG, Bambounou, Z.I.P.P.O, Truncate, Alignment, Fabrizio Rat and many others to the imprint to date.


Personal life

Born in 1989, Regal grew up and lives in Madrid. He expresses his admiration for the city in an interview with Groove: "We don't have hesea here, but Madrid is a beautiful city that I know well. For me it is the most beautiful city in the world. A city full of possibilities. Whatever you want to do, you can do it here." Regal's interest in music was always prevalent, but the serious interest in DJ-ing began in his early teen years, when he started playing around with a demo sequencer that he got with a package of cornflakes, he explains in an interview with Music Radar.
